really simple and common-sensical... 20% alcohol (I used reagent-grade 95% ethanol, not 'denatured'; but pure isopropanol or even methanol should be reasonable, too) in high quality distilled or RODI water (I used 18 megohm-cm HPLC grade water, since I have some 'in stock') and a wetting agent (surfactant). I cannot find our Photo-Flo (still buried in the basement rubble) so I did a little Google-level research and convinced myself that a drop of dishwasher rinse-aid was 'close enough for government work'.
No warranty expressed or implied! ;-) -

Gong ~ Flying TeapotGong was formed in 1967, after Allen—then a member of Soft Machine—was denied re-entry to the United Kingdom because of a visa complication. Allen remained in France where he and a London-born Sorbonne professor, Gilli Smyth, established the first incarnation of the band.
